We are seeking an exceptionally polished, proactive, and resourceful Executive Assistant/Office Manager to support two Co-Founders of a fast-growing technology startup. This is a high-visibility role for an individual who thrives in an entrepreneurial environment, enjoys being at the center of the business, and can seamlessly balance sophisticated executive support with hands-on office operations.
 
Responsibilities of the Executive Assistant:
-Provide high-level, proactive administrative support to two Co-Founders, serving as a trusted partner and gatekeeper.
-Manage complex, frequently changing calendars across multiple time zones, strategically prioritizing meetings and protecting the Co-Founders' time.
-Coordinate extensive domestic and international travel, including flights, hotels, ground transportation, itineraries, and last-minute changes.
-Prepare the Co-Founders for meetings by organizing agendas, briefing materials, presentations, and relevant background information.
-Coordinate internal and external meetings with investors, board members, clients, partners, and senior executives.
-Manage meeting follow-ups, action items, and key deadlines to ensure timely execution.
-Own the day-to-day operations of the company's office, ensuring it is organized, welcoming, and functioning efficiently.
-Serve as the primary point of contact for office vendors, building management, IT, maintenance, cleaning, security, and other service providers.
-Manage office supplies, equipment, pantry, snacks, and general workplace needs.
-Coordinate office events, team gatherings, celebrations, happy hours, lunches, and company-wide meetings.
-Serve as a professional liaison between the Co-Founders and employees, investors, clients, partners, and other external stakeholders.
-Draft and manage correspondence, communications, presentations, and other confidential materials.
-Handle highly sensitive business and personal information with discretion and sound judgment.
-Assist with special projects and ad hoc initiatives on behalf of the Co-Founders.
-Anticipate the Co-Founders' needs and proactively identify solutions before issues arise.
-Take ownership of cross-functional projects and initiatives as assigned by the Co-Founders.
 
Requirements of the Executive Assistant:
-3+ years of experience supporting C-suite executives, founders, entrepreneurs, or senior leaders.
-Previous experience in a technology, startup, venture-backed, or high-growth company strongly preferred.
-Experience supporting multiple executives simultaneously in a fast-paced environment strongly preferred.
-Highly proficient in Google Workspace; comfortable learning new technology and AI-enabled tools.
-Strong project management sk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ities and deadlines.
-Exceptional attention to detail and follow-through.
-Demonstrated ability to exercise discretion and maintain confidentiality.
-Highly proactive and solutions-oriented with excellent judgment.
-Comfortable operating in an environment where priorities can shift quickly and processes are still being built.
-Ability to work independently, take ownership, and anticipate needs without constant direction.
